The size of the file is over 2 GiB. Files larger than 2 GiB are not supported by ISO9660 standard in its first and second versions (the most widespread ones).
It is recommended to use the third version of ISO9660 standard which is supported by most of the operating systems including Linux and all versions of Windows ©.
However MacOS X cannot read images created with version 3 of ISO9660 standard.
